Patong ( Thai : ป่า ตอง ) is a municipality ( tambon ) in the district ( Amphoe ) Kathu in the province of Phuket . Phuket is located in the southern region of Thailand . In the municipality is the Patong Beach ( Thai หาด ป่า ตอง - Hat Patong, English: Patong Beach ), a well-known beach and tourist resort on the west coast of the island of Phuket .

Patong Beach, a 3.5 km long beach that runs along the entire western side of the town of Patong, is the main holiday destination of the island, known for its nightlife and the shopping malls, where you can shop cheaply. From the end of the 1980s, the beach became increasingly popular, especially among Western European tourists. There are many hotels and hotel chains there. Patong Beach is also popular with diving tourists.

climate

The island of Phuket has a tropical climate with a dry season from November to April and a rainy season from May to October. Average temperatures are relatively constant all year round. Average maximum temperatures range from 29 to 33 ° C and average minimum temperatures from 23 to 26 ° C.

Incidents

On December 26, 2004, Patong Beach, like many other coastal areas on the west side of Phuket and Thailand, was hit by a tsunami caused by the 2004 Indian Ocean quake . The tsunami wave caused great devastation on the coast and the flat hinterland and many people were killed. Patong Beach was one of the hardest hit areas of Phuket, although the destruction here was not nearly as bad as in neighboring Khao Lak .
